Bayern and three other Brandenburg-class frigates were designed as replacements for the Hamburg-class destroyers. She was laid down in 1993 at the yards of Nordseewerke, Emden and launched in June 1994. She was christened by Karin Stoiber, the wife of the then Minister-President of Bavaria Edmund Stoiber. After undergoing trials she was commissioned on 15 June 1996. She is propelled by two diesel engines and two GE gas turbines. She has Thales D-Band and F-Band radar systems and is armed with Sea Sparrow surface to air missiles, Exocet missile, an Oto Melara 76, and MK46 torpedoes.
